For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public high schools serving 806 students in Brookhaven School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Mississippi.
Public High Schools in Brookhaven School District have an average math proficiency score of 28% (versus the Mississippi public high school average of 58%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 42% statewide average).
Public High School in Brookhaven School District have a Graduation Rate of 81%, which is less than the Mississippi average of 89%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Brookhaven High School, with 81%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Mississippi or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 71%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Mississippi public high school average of 55% (majority Black).

Brookhaven School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 147 school districts in Mississippi (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 81% has increased from 79%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$12,499 is higher than the state median of $12,205. The school district revenue/student has grown by 17%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,441 is less than the state median of $12,074. The school district spending/student has grown by 15% over four school years.
